HONGKONG, 23rd November. The freight market continues in about the same condition as last reported, with a fair amount of business on record. From Saigon to Hongkong, 2 steaners have been chartered at 13 cents per picul, and more tonnage might be placed at this rate; to Java 32 cents last; to Philippines, 37) cents per picul can be obtained for a small carrier. Philip- pines to one port Japan, 38 40 cents per picul is offered. Java to Hongkong, 45 cents per picul has been paid for wet sugar, but at the moiuent there is no further enquiry and 32 cents per picul might be obtained for dry sugar. Bangkok to Hongkong, 35 and 40 cents per picul (with down- ward cargo) is offered for medium-sized steamers for a few consecutive trips. Japan coal freights.— Moji to Hongkong, $3.10 to $3.15 per ton firm ; to Singapore, $3.25 per ton. Sailing vessels.- Nothing new under this head.
